Canada, US: The producer received an order to deliver 3 trains for Canadian operator Ontario Northland. At the same time the manufacturer finished designing push-pull Venture trains under a large-scale contract with Amtrak.
USA: Wabtec together with scientific laboratories and the Convergent Science company will work to create a control system for the engine that is to burn a hydrogen-diesel mixture.
USA: The operator presented two seven-car trains manufactured at the Stadler plant in Salt Lake City. It is planned that 19 such trains will be put into operation on the San Francisco-San Jose line in 2024.
USA: A $1.7 bln option would allow the manufacturer to expand the contract with the MTA to supply 1,175 metro cars. At the same time, Kawasaki announced that the delivery of the first trains was delayed by 1.5 years.
USA: In September, the company received orders from three manufacturers - Siemens Mobility, Stadler, and Medha Servo Drives. It is planned to equip multiple unit rolling stock with fuel cells.
USA: The operator and the ZTR company announced a partnership to convert the old diesel locomotive to hybrid diesel-battery traction. The prototype is expected to be released at the end of 2023.
USA: The country’s Department of Defense has included CRRC in the list of companies that are suspected to carry out a defense order in China. Based on this list, the US President may introduce sanctions later.
